Tractor-Trailer Crash Shuts Down I-81 Northbound Near Woodstock, Virginia
A tractor-trailer crash has shut down all northbound lanes of Interstate 81 just south of Woodstock, Virginia, leading to significant traffic backups and the implementation of a detour.

Harrisonburg, VA, September 17, 2026 —
All northbound lanes of Interstate 81 have been closed south of Woodstock, Virginia, following a crash involving a tractor-trailer. The incident has resulted in substantial traffic delays and prompted authorities to establish a detour for affected motorists.
The closure occurred on Interstate 81, a major transportation artery. The specific location was identified as being just south of Woodstock, Virginia. Emergency crews and law enforcement were dispatched to the scene of the collision. The exact cause of the tractor-trailer crash was not immediately available.
As a result of the shutdown, significant traffic backups developed throughout the afternoon. Commuters and freight transport experienced considerable delays. To alleviate congestion and reroute traffic, officials implemented a detour. Further details regarding the route of the detour were not provided.
The duration of the lane closures and the timeline for clearing the incident were also not specified. Authorities are advising drivers to seek alternative routes and to expect extended travel times in the affected area. Updates on the status of the northbound lanes are expected as the situation develops.
